The band did say why they dont play it live anymore, because they cant nail it on the stage. And the bass is the lead instrument in this song, so Jeff would need to change the tone of his bass that works great as doing the base, but suffers when is the lead instrument...for example Get Right blows live and one of the mais reasons is because the bass doesnt have the "snap" that a lead instrument requires.
